The Thanjavur Big Temple, also known as the Brihadeeswarar Temple or Rajarajesvaram Temple, features impressive gopurams (tower-like gateways) built by Chola emperor Rajaraja I in the early 11th century (around 1010 AD). The temple, dedicated to Lord Shiva, was built by Chola king Rajaraja I (985-1012 AD) and completed around 1010 AD. The temple showcases Dravidian architectural style, with massive gopurams and a large complex
Common Themes in Dove Paintings:
-
Peace and Harmony
-
Doves are frequently used in peace-themed art, especially with olive branches in their beaks. This imagery originates from ancient and biblical traditions and is a universal symbol of reconciliation and calm.
-
-
Spiritual and Religious Symbolism
-
In Christian art, doves often represent the Holy Spirit. A white dove descending is a common depiction of divine presence or inspiration, particularly in scenes like the baptism of Jesus.
-
-
Love and Devotion
-
Doves are also known to mate for life, making them symbols of enduring love and fidelity. Romantic or sentimental artworks sometimes use doves to express pure affection.
-
-
Freedom and Innocence
-
When portrayed in flight, doves can symbolize freedom of the soul, innocence, or the transcendence of earthly concerns.
